国产男女无遮挡_日本在线播放一区_国产精品黄页免费高清在线观看_国产精品爽爽爽

  • 熱門標簽

當前位置: 主頁 > 航空資料 > 計算機 >

時間:2010-08-09 13:24來源:藍天飛行翻譯 作者:admin
曝光臺 注意防騙 網曝天貓店富美金盛家居專營店坑蒙拐騙欺詐消費者

<xsl:template match=”ATOM”>
<xsl:apply-templates
select=”MELTING_POINT”/>
</xsl:template>
<xsl:template match=”MELTING_POINT”>
<xsl:copy-of select=”..”>
<xsl:apply-templates select=”*|@*|pi()|text()”/>
</xsl:copy-of>
</xsl:template>
<xsl:template match=”* | @* | pi() | text()”>
<xsl:copy>
<xsl:apply-templates select=”* | @* | pi() | text()”/>
XML 實用大全
第 505 頁
</xsl:copy>
</xsl:template>
</xsl:stylesheet>
這是一個從源符號集到同一個符號集的XSL 轉換的例子。不像本章中的大多數例子那樣,此例不轉換成結構整潔的HTML。
XML 實用大全
第 506 頁
14.11 使用xsl:number 為節點計數
xsl:number 在輸出文檔中插入格式化整數。由expr 特性計算出來的數值,通過四舍五入成最接近的整數,然后根據format
特性值,對此整數進行格式化,從而獲得整數值。為這兩個特性提供了恰當的缺省值。例如,考查清單14-17 中的ATOM 元
素的樣式單。
清單14-17:為原子計數的XSL 樣式單
<?xml version="1.0"?>
<xsl:stylesheet
xmlns:xsl="http://www.w3.org/XSL/Transform/1.0">
<xsl:template match="PERIODIC_TABLE">
<html>
<head><title>The Elements</title></head>
<body>
<table>
<xsl:apply-templates select="ATOM"/>
</table>
</body>
</html>
</xsl:template>
<xsl:template match="ATOM">
<tr>
<td><xsl:number expr="position()"/></td>
<td><xsl:value-of select="NAME"/></td>
</tr>
</xsl:template>
</xsl:stylesheet>
XML 實用大全
第 507 頁
當此樣式單應用于清單14-1 時,輸出類似如下顯示:
<html><head><title>The
Elements</title></head><body><table><tr><td>l</td><td>Hydrogen<
/td></tr>
<tr><td>2</td><td>Helium</td></tr>
</table></body></html>
由于氫是其父元素的第一個ATOM 元素,所以其號碼為1。由于氦是其父元素的第二個ATOM 元素,所以其號碼為2。(這些
號碼對應于氫和氦的原子序數,這種對應關系是清單14-1 的副產品,而清單14-1 正是以原子序數的順序進行排列的。)
14.11.1 缺省數值
如果使用expr 特性來計算編號,那么這就是所需要的值。但是,如果省略expr 特性,那么源樹形結構中的當前節點位置就
作為編號來使用。但是,可使用下面三個特性來調整此缺省值:
• level
• count
• from
這三個特性是從以前的不支持較為復雜的表達式XSL 草案中延續下來的。如果它們完全使你混淆,那么我建議不要
去考慮它們,使用expr 來代替。
14.11.1.1 level 特性
按缺省行為,當不存在expr 特性時,xsl:number 可對源節點的同屬節點加以計數。例如,如果對ATOMIC_NUMBER 元素而不
是ATOM 元素加以編號,那么由于一個ATOM 元素絕不會有多個ATOMIC_NUMBER 子元素,所以任何一個編號都不會大于1。盡
管文檔包含多個ATOMIC_NUMBER 元素,但它們不是同屬的。
將xsl:number 的level 特性設置成any,可對與文檔中當前節點同類的所有元素加以計數。此情況不僅包括與當前規則相
匹配的元素,還包括類型與要求相一致的所有元素。例如,即使只選擇氣體的原子序數,固體和液體也仍然計數在內(即便
固體和液體沒有輸出也是如此)。看看下面的這些規則:
<xsl:template match="ATOM">
<xsl:apply-templates select="NAME"/>
</xsl:template>
<xsl:template match="NAME">
XML 實用大全
第 508 頁
<td><xsl:number level="any"/></td>
<td><xsl:value-of select="."/></td>
</xsl:template>
由于level 設置成any,上面的規則對每個新的NAME 元素產生的輸出不是從1 開始,其輸出結果如下:
<td>l</td><td>Hydrogen</td>
<td>2</td><td>Helium</td>
如果刪除level 特性或設置成缺省的single 值,那么輸出結果如下:
<td>l</td><td>Hydrogen</td>
<td>l</td><td>Helium</td>
另一個不大有用的方法將xsl:number 的level 特性設置成multi,以便對當前節點的同屬及其祖先(但不是當前節點同屬
的子節點)加以計數。
14.11.1.2 count 特性
按缺省行為,當沒有expr 特性時,只對與當前節點元素同類的元素加以計數。但可以將xsl-number 的count 特性設置成選
擇表達式,從而指定對什么元素加以計數。例如,下面的規則對ATOM 的所有子元素進行編號:
<xsl:template match="ATOM/*">
<td><xsl:number count="*"/></td>
<td><xsl:value-of select="."/></td>
</xsl:template>
應用此規則獲得的輸出結果如下:
<td>l</td><td>Helium</td>
<td>2</td><td>He</td>
 
中國航空網 m.k6050.com
航空翻譯 www.aviation.cn
本文鏈接地址:XML實用大全(143)
国产男女无遮挡_日本在线播放一区_国产精品黄页免费高清在线观看_国产精品爽爽爽
真实国产乱子伦对白视频| 久久久久久九九九九| 777午夜精品福利在线观看| 国产精品户外野外| 热99精品只有里视频精品| 高清在线观看免费| 欧美日本精品在线| 免费国产黄色网址| 久久久国产精品亚洲一区| 色噜噜狠狠色综合网| 97精品在线视频| 影音先锋欧美在线| 国产精选一区二区| 九九久久国产精品| 国产日本欧美一区二区三区| 国产精品后入内射日本在线观看| 欧美日韩另类综合| 国产黑人绿帽在线第一区| 无码人妻aⅴ一区二区三区日本| 国产精品夜夜夜一区二区三区尤| 国产精品国产福利国产秒拍| 黄色影视在线观看| 国产精品美女视频网站| 欧美精品一区二区三区免费播放| 国产成人精品一区二区三区福利 | 国产精品高潮呻吟久久av野狼 | 久久久免费看| 午夜精品久久久久久久久久久久久| 97免费视频在线| 午夜精品99久久免费| 91精品国产高清自在线| 日韩aⅴ视频一区二区三区| 国产成人综合久久| 欧美欧美一区二区| 国产精品成人在线| 成人精品一区二区三区电影免费| 亚洲一区二区三区免费观看| 久久久久高清| 欧美牲交a欧美牲交aⅴ免费下载 | 欧美精品在线看| 高清不卡日本v二区在线| 亚洲精品一品区二品区三品区| 久久久亚洲国产| 品久久久久久久久久96高清| 国产精品久久久久久久天堂第1集 国产精品久久久久久久午夜 | 欧美中文在线免费| 国产精品国产精品国产专区不卡 | 欧美日韩亚洲免费| 精品国产福利| 91福利视频在线观看| 秋霞无码一区二区| 国产精品国产三级国产专播精品人 | 亚洲精品成人自拍| 色999日韩欧美国产| 国产在线久久久| 伊人久久大香线蕉午夜av| 久久久99精品视频| 欧美日韩国产免费一区二区三区| 久热精品视频在线免费观看| 91精品国产高清久久久久久91| 欧美在线激情网| 久久国产精品久久久久久久久久| 91精品久久久久久久久久久久久久| 日韩欧美精品一区二区三区经典| 国产精品日日做人人爱| 国产精品自拍偷拍| 日本不卡一二三区| 久久国产精品网站| 久久免费视频在线观看| 精品www久久久久奶水| 亚洲最新免费视频| 日韩最新在线视频| 99久久国产免费免费| 激情综合在线观看| 亚洲精品欧美精品| 国产精品成久久久久三级| …久久精品99久久香蕉国产| 国内精品久久久久久中文字幕| 亚洲国产精品久久久久爰色欲| 国产精品入口免费视| 91精品国产高清久久久久久91| 欧美成人精品欧美一级乱| 亚洲va国产va天堂va久久| 久久亚洲一区二区三区四区五区高| 国产成人精品视| 国产欧美综合精品一区二区| 日韩免费在线免费观看| 中文字幕中文字幕一区三区 | 国产一区二区在线免费| 日本视频久久久| 一区二区三区在线观看www| 久久久www成人免费精品张筱雨| 91九色国产社区在线观看| 欧美日韩电影一区二区| 日韩av免费一区| 欧美激情喷水视频| 久久激情视频免费观看| 91精品国产成人| 国产欧美一区二区三区久久人妖 | 久久艹国产精品| 国产一区二区在线视频播放| 青青草综合在线| 色噜噜狠狠色综合网| 在线观看成人一级片| 久久国产精品偷| 日本一本草久p| 日本在线观看天堂男亚洲| 日本一区二区三区在线播放| 日日骚一区二区网站| 91av视频在线免费观看| 日韩视频在线观看国产| 午夜老司机精品| 亚洲三区视频| 亚洲中文字幕无码专区| 欧美日本国产在线| 美女精品视频一区| 久久亚洲成人精品| 国产精品美女网站| 国产精品美女免费视频| 久久精品国产清自在天天线| 天天在线免费视频| 久操成人在线视频| 亚洲一区精彩视频| 午夜精品区一区二区三| 欧美在线视频一二三| 国产尤物91| 91精品免费看| 国产成人无码精品久久久性色| 国产精品成人在线| 亚洲成人精品电影在线观看| 欧洲国产精品| 国产免费黄色av| 久久资源亚洲| 国产精品网站免费| 亚洲综合精品伊人久久| 热门国产精品亚洲第一区在线 | 日本亚洲欧美成人| 蜜桃av噜噜一区二区三区| av观看免费在线| 国产成人自拍视频在线观看| 国产精品免费看一区二区三区| 一区二区成人国产精品| 日韩欧美一区二区视频在线播放 | 国产一区视频免费观看| 97人人模人人爽人人喊中文字 | 欧美最猛性xxxx| 国产又粗又猛又爽又黄的网站| 91精品国产91久久久久久不卡| 久久久国产精品x99av| 一区二区精品在线观看| 青青久久av北条麻妃黑人| 国产伦精品一区二区三区四区视频 | 久久久久久久影院| 蜜臀久久99精品久久久久久宅男| 日韩av第一页| 国产精品一区二区久久| 久久久久久久久久久av| 一级一片免费播放| 欧美大陆一区二区| 久久久亚洲欧洲日产国码aⅴ| 不卡av电影在线观看| 日韩国产欧美一区| 成人精品久久久| 国产精品国产三级国产aⅴ9色 | 日韩不卡视频一区二区| 国产欧美自拍视频| 久久久极品av| 日本欧美精品在线| 91久久精品日日躁夜夜躁国产| 久久伊人免费视频| 欧美在线免费观看| 久久免费成人精品视频| 亚洲最新在线| 国产视频福利一区| 久久精品久久久久久国产 免费| 亚洲国产精品视频一区| 国产日韩一区二区在线观看| 日韩视频永久免费观看| 日本公妇乱淫免费视频一区三区| 99爱精品视频| 在线观看一区二区三区三州| 精品视频一区在线| 国产精品视频免费一区二区三区| 日韩在线综合网| 91久久国产自产拍夜夜嗨| 美女扒开尿口让男人操亚洲视频网站| 欧美日本韩国国产| 日韩在线观看免费av| 日韩欧美国产综合在线| 久久偷看各类wc女厕嘘嘘偷窃| 精品国产乱码久久久久久蜜柚| 毛片一区二区三区四区| 国产精品视频中文字幕91| 青草成人免费视频| www.xxxx欧美| 欧美与黑人午夜性猛交久久久 | 欧美一区二区影院| 久久久久久久999精品视频| 日本精品久久久久久久久久| 国产精品91在线|